Abstract(in English) | A reliable method for measuring vocal tract cross-sectional area functions is needed for the refinement of a model for articulatory-acoustic mapping, and the measured functions should retain the inherent acoustic property of the vocal tract. In this article, the performance of the acoustical measurement method proposed by Sondhi and others is quantitatively evaluated. Some experiments were carried out using a lot of cavities in which there were one or two constricted parts in different positions and of different size. The relationship between the configuration of a cavity and the accuracy of estimation of its cross-sectional areas was investigated. The effect of a viscous loss factor on the estimation procedure was also evaluated. The nonlinear optimization method for the incident signal was proposed in order to improve the precision and repeatability of the estimation of acoustic measurement. |
